    About this House

    INCREDIBLE PIECE OF LAND IN TOWN OF GREENVILLE TO BUILD ON! LOCATED IN THE SEWER SERVICE AREA OF TOWN OF GREENVILLE. Enjoy the Beauty of this Land with Mix of Farmland and Trees. GREAT HUNTING RIGHT OUT YOUR BACK DOOR! Or Plenty of Space for a Home Business...
    spring rd, greenville, WI 54942 is a lot/land. It last sold for $138,000 on Apr 28, 2017.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ate rent is $1,670/month.

    • Scott H.
      "Very quiet neighborhood. Great neighborhood for families, couples and retiree's. Good mix of well behaved kids and teenagers. Very quiet and peaceful. Most neighbor's are friendly but tend to keep to themselves for the most part. The children , seem to get along well. A couple of neighborhood activities during the summer months, an annual Christmas party at a local restaurant. Many summer time activities at Lion's Park, a 15 minute walk or 4 minute drive including a summer rock concert which you can hear in your back yard. Overall, a quiet neighborhood with no crime and a couple of parks within walking distance."
